BOSSO’S BIG TEST!  Can Highlanders end FC Platinum’s stranglehold at Emagumeni?

Innocent Kurira at Barbourfields Stadium, Zimpapers Sports Hub

ALL roads lead to Emagumeni this Sunday as Highlanders square off against their ultimate bogey team, the mighty FC Platinum, in a Castle Lager Premier Soccer League showdown set to light up Barbourfields Stadium.

The stats don’t lie: since FC Platinum stormed into the top flight, they’ve bossed Bosso, chalking up 11 wins in 23 league clashes. Highlanders have only managed six victories, and last season’s double defeat — 2–0 in Zvishavane and 1–0 at Barbourfields — still stings for the black and white faithful.

This time, Bosso fans are daring to dream. With a fired-up squad and home advantage, could this finally be the day they turn the tables on the four-time champions?
